Differences in Inpatient Alcohol and Drug Rehab in Newark, Delaware

Today, different inpatient drug treatment programs vary regarding the outline and execution of their drug and alcohol addiction rehabilitation offerings and services. For example, the length of time you will spend participating in therapy and detoxification will vary from one center to another. Whereas some facilities last close to 9 months or longer, others will be short and take about 30 days.

In the same way, these programs in Newark vary regarding the level of autonomy and freedom you will have while participating in drug and alcohol addiction treatment. Some of the programs are locked down, meaning that you won't be able to leave the program as you address your substance abuse and any co-occurring mental health issues. In such a center, you might not even be able to access the internet or have visitors. Other centers, however, might allow you some leeway to interact with the world outside while still remaining focused on full recovery.

When you select inpatient drug and alcohol treatment, therefore, it is crucial that you examine different programs and choose the one that best suits your needs. Some of the aspects you should look at include:

a) Monetary Policies

Ask the residential center whether they accept insurance, provide financial support, and have a number of payment options.

b) Offerings and Services

You should also look into and find out what the Newark, DE. treatment facility has to offer regarding accommodation, food, recreation, therapy, and other aspects of drug addiction rehab.

As you continue evaluating different inp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ation centers, keep in mind that no given program will work for every addict. To this end, it might be in your best interests to carefully determine what every facility can provide until you get to a center that is best suited to meet your requirements and preferences.

Overall, inpatient alcohol and drug treatment is among the most effective of all types of drug and alcohol addiction rehab protocols. The time you spend in one of these facilities will make sure that you can productively focus on your recovery free from the temptations and triggers that you may encounter if you choose outpatient treatment.
